Heron (Eons)

October 2011 Visual: Digital Painting Neolithic cultures viewed water-birds as representatives of creative Gods, sometimes as Gods themselves. Thriving in water, sky and on land these creatures were symbols of Cosmic Water- a fluid yet unchanging constant of life. The image is of the Great Blue Heron amidst a waving line and opposed dots- a pattern used by cultures 10,000 years ago to honor the Cosmic Water. Audio: Micro-Loop/ Percssion/ Bass/ Synths "Eons spring and flood from the expanded wing/ The quiet watch within all planes that defies all kings" The composition begins with a repetitive tone and rhythm that gradually sophisticates. The ensuing harmonics, polyrhythms, and melodic structure never divorce themselves from the impulse of the original loop. The regal Heron stands quiet, takes flight and dives- a metaphor for the eternal change and essential power of creation that no earthly ruler can suppress.
